    Overview

    Description
    Contains a postcard sent to Frau Julie Brasiak in Poland from Brasvak [illegible] in the Sachsenhausen concentration camp; written on pre-printed camp postcard; dated December 21, 1941; and a letter sent to Marie Mika in Litzmannstadt (Łódź) from Tadeusz Mika, who was imprisoned at the Dachau concentration camp; written on pre-printed camp stationery; dated December 16, 1944.
